Pediatric mortality from neurofibromatosis and malignant peripheral nerve sheath tumors in Brazil, 2008-2023: a 16-year nationwide analysis of persistent disparities.

Neurofibromatosis (NF) comprises genetic tumor predisposition syndromes with multisystem involvement, yet pediatric mortality data remain scarce in middle-income settings. Malignant peripheral nerve sheath tumors (MPNST) represent the leading cause of premature death in this population. This study analyzed 16-year temporal trends and regional disparities in pediatric NF/MPNST mortality and hospitalizations in Brazil.

We conducted a nationwide ecological study of individuals aged 0-19 years from 2008 to 2023. Mortality data were obtained from the Mortality Information System (SIM) and hospital admissions from the Hospital Information System (SIH/SUS), with temporal trends assessed using Prais-Winsten regression. We calculated Age-Specific Mortality Rates (ASMRs) and assessed excess mortality risk using Standardized Mortality Ratios (SMR) to identify regional disparities.

A total of 177 pediatric deaths were identified, with MPNST accounting for 64.9% (N = 115) and NF for 35.1% (N = 62). SMR analysis revealed significant geographic inequalities. Children aged 0-9 in the South region faced a mortality risk double that of the reference population (SMR = 2.02; 95% CI 1.08-3.46; p = 0.010), whereas adolescents in the North region exhibited significantly lower-than-expected mortality. Despite global therapeutic advances, mortality rates in Brazil remained statistically stagnant across all age groups and conditions (p values were non-significant). Conversely, NF-related hospitalizations demonstrated an increasing trend (+ 2.98% annually for ages 0-9; + 1.94% for ages 10-19), while MPNST admissions remained stable.

Pediatric mortality from NF and MPNST in Brazil has remained unchanged for 16 years, contrasting with the rising trend in NF-related hospitalizations. This discrepancy, coupled with marked regional disparities, suggests persistent structural challenges in early diagnosis and equitable access to specialized oncology care. These findings highlight a critical need for national notification systems and improved therapeutic strategies for affected children and adolescents.
